Mexican Memory Game or Flash Cards: Animals
Memory is a simple and easy-to-learn matching game that builds cognitive skills and confidence in children. Simply print out two copies of our pdf pages, cut out the cards, and you're ready to play!
This template includes eight cards that each have an image of an animal native to Mexico, the same images be found in larger format in our Animals of Mexico coloring book . Use both together for a fun way to learn about these animals!
Supplies Needed
- download the Memory Game or Flash Cards: Animals of Mexico template (below)
- printer
- scissors
Preparation
- Print two copies of each page.
- Cut out the cards, place facedown on a flat surface.
- Instruct your child to look at two cards at a time, flipping them up to view and then turning down again in the same place.
- When matching sets are found, set them aside or have fun coloring them in!
